Polycythemia Management

Meaning

Polycythemia Management refers to the clinical strategies employed to monitor and mitigate the risk associated with an abnormally high concentration of red blood cells (erythrocytosis), a condition often observed as a side effect of exogenous testosterone replacement therapy (TRT). This management typically involves regular hematocrit and hemoglobin monitoring to detect rising red blood cell mass. Therapeutic interventions, when indicated, primarily include phlebotomy, which is the controlled removal of blood, or adjustments to the TRT regimen, such as lowering the dose or changing the route of administration. Effective management is crucial for reducing the risk of thrombotic events.
